Add to Wishlist Add to Compare OE N0245226 N 024 522 6 Other engine bay... €24.72 add to cart Add to Wishlist Add to Compare OE 059010158A Attention sticker Other engine... €21.23 add to cart Add to Wishlist Add to Compare OE 811407181a Other engine bay part Audi 80... €27.68 add to cart Add to Wishlist Add to Compare OE A2115050715 Other engine bay part... €22.92 add to cart
Add to Wishlist Add to Compare OE 059010158A Attention sticker Other engine... €21.23 add to cart Add to Wishlist Add to Compare OE 811407181a Other engine bay part Audi 80... €27.68 add to cart Add to Wishlist Add to Compare OE A2115050715 Other engine bay part... €22.92 add to cart
Add to Wishlist Add to Compare OE 811407181a Other engine bay part Audi 80... €27.68 add to cart Add to Wishlist Add to Compare OE A2115050715 Other engine bay part... €22.92 add to cart